Plastic welding equipment is a type of equipment used for joining two or more pieces of plastic together using heat, pressure, and cooling. Plastic welding equipment is a type of equipment used for joining two or more pieces of plastic together using heat, pressure, and cooling. In plastic welding process, two parts are organized and then pressed together at the planned joins.
It can be done with the help of many equipments such as guns, ultrasonic welding equipment, hot rod welders, radio frequency, irons, dielectric welders, and hot plate welders. This plastic welding equipment also offer various frictional or specialty processes, including friction welding, ultrasonic welding, gas torch brazing, hot rod or iron welding, and laser welding.

Traditional plastic welding methods such as ultrasonic welding, hot plate welding, and solvent bonding are being improved with new techniques. Laser welding is one of the emerging welding method, offering precise and efficient bonding of plastic components. Additionally, advancements in infrared and induction welding techniques are improving the speed and quality of plastic welding processes.
The integration of automation, data exchange, and artificial intelligence is revolutionizing the manufacturing landscape. In plastic welding, Industry 4.0 technologies are streamlining production processes, optimizing quality control, and enabling real-time monitoring of manufacturing operations.
Smart sensors, robotics, and data analytics are being employed to enhance efficiency, productivity, and overall performance. Therefore, new techniques and technological changes are expected to drive the market for plastic welding equipment during the forecast period.

The use of plastic welding machines has certain disadvantages. These machines cause major harm or even injury when not utilized correctly. They require a certain amount of competence to operate. Some plastic welding machines are very costly, which is one of their main drawbacks. Furthermore, the use of heat to fuse plastics together results in the production of hazardous vapors from these devices, which necessitate proper ventilation to ensure operator safety.
The cost of consumables for the welding machine such as welding rods and gas mount up through the time. Furthermore, the cost of plastic welding machines increase, due to the need for maintenance and upkeep. These elements are limiting the expansion of the plastic welding equipment market.
Many research and development activities are happening to improve the exiting plastic welding techniques as well as create a new plastic welding techniques to provide efficiency and ease. For example, a novel plastic welding method, Pinweld, uses a small, light, low-energy, and self-regulating tool to fuse plastic parts together.
Its method of precisely heating the interface between two plastic components is less intrusive than other current methods, which sometimes require costly heating mechanisms and large equipment. Pinweld was first created to join flat sheets, and it has been successful in achieving joint strengths for a variety of plastic materials that are nearly as strong as the parent material.
Many other innovations are happening in the exiting techniques such as creating an improved version of ultrasonic welding machine for medical devices, creating opportunities of the market growth.

Coherent Corp. launched HIGHtactile, a new laser welding head
On May 31, 2023, Coherent Corp. launched HIGHtactile, a new laser welding head with tactile seam-tracking technology that suitable for electric vehicle (EV) manufacturing applications. The growing demand for EVs is expanding applications for lasers in automotive manufacturing, spurring innovations in process automation and improvements in laser usability.
The new product is easily configurable to perform highly automated fillet welding and brazing. HIGHtactile is extremely user-friendly, due to its wide range of embedded sensors that streamline almost every functional aspect of the welding head. The sensors improve process learning and enable fast laser processing. It is configured to maximize performance for specific applications such as brazing steel or welding aluminum and steel.
Nippon Avionics Co.,Ltd. introduced the HW-D series Ultrasonic Handheld Welder
On May 29, 2020, Nippon Avionics Co.,Ltd. introduced the HW-D series Ultrasonic Handheld Welder. This tool is capable of performing various oscillation modes, making it ideal for different applications. It is used for both manual operation and automated systems.
This model welds fine bosses or crimp plastic ribs that are difficult to handle. It offers optimal welding capabilities for a range of applications, including welding and crimping of automobile interior trim, plastic crimping in electronic assembly, welding of unwoven cloth (such as masks), and even cutting of rubber.
